gpt4 book ai didi

asp.net-core - 为什么 Microsoft.CodeAnalysis 与 ASP.NET Core 网站一起发布?

转载 作者:行者123 更新时间:2023-12-04 12:02:42 26 4
gpt4 key购买 nike

我正在发布一个 ASP.NET Core MVC 3.0 网站,并且输出文件夹包含许多对 Microsoft.CodeAnalysis 的多种语言的引用。图书馆,有人知道为什么吗?

当然是 FxCopAnalyzers Nuget 包已安装在项目中,但它没有在项目的早期版本中发布,所以我不明白为什么现在这样,因为它应该只在开发时有用,而不是在生产环境中。

最佳答案

就我而言,问题是“Microsoft.VisualStudio.Web.CodeGeneration.Design”。我需要更改“.csproj”文件中的包引用以包含 ExcludeAssets="all" :

<PackageReference Include="Microsoft.VisualStudio.Web.CodeGeneration.Design" Version="3.1.1" ExcludeAssets="All" />

关于asp.net-core - 为什么 Microsoft.CodeAnalysis 与 ASP.NET Core 网站一起发布?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58291135/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com